About the Role
Reporting to the Executive Manager Corporate Services, this position is responsible for ensuring compliance with all legislation, codes and guidelines as they apply to building and construction. The Principal Building Surveyor is also responsible for liaising with the community, builders, architects, developers and engineers with respect to the legislative requirements for new construction.
What we’re Looking For
The ideal candidate will have experience as a Local Government Building Surveyor, with a proactive, business supportive, customer focused and solution driven attitude.
You will have a demonstrated working knowledge of the Building Act 2011, Building Regulations 2012, Building Code of Australia and other relevant legislation, along with demonstrated working knowledge of the application of building surveying functions, including assessment and compliance of building matters.
